Overview of Omron G7SA-3A1B-DC24

The Omron G7SA-3A1B-DC24 is a safety relay with forcibly guided contacts designed for reliable switching in safety circuits. It features a 4-pole relay configuration with 3 normally open (3PST-NO) and 1 normally closed (SPST-NC) contacts. The relay is operated by a 24 V DC coil and is suitable for safety applications requiring high contact reliability and electrical isolation.

Key Features

  • Coil voltage: 24 V DC.
  • Contact configuration: 4 poles (3PST-NO + 1SPST-NC).
  • Rated load current: 6 A at 250 VAC or 30 V DC (resistive load).
  • Coil resistance: Approximately 1600 Ω.
  • Power consumption: Approx. 360 mW.
  • Contact resistance: Maximum 100 mΩ.
  • Insulation resistance: Minimum 1000 MΩ at 500 V DC between coil and contacts.
  • Dielectric strength: 4000 VAC between coil and contacts for 1 minute.
  • Operating time: Maximum 20 ms.
  • Release time: Maximum 10 ms.
  • Mechanical endurance: 36,000 operations per hour (mechanical).
  • Electrical endurance: 1,800 operations per hour at rated load.
  • Operating temperature: -25 to 55 °C (no icing or condensation).
  • Mounting: PCB terminal type.
  • Safety Standards: Complies with EN50205 Class A (forcibly guided contacts). Certified by VDE.

Applications

The G7SA-3A1B-DC24 relay is used in safety circuits of machinery and equipment where positive-guided contacts are necessary to meet safety standards. Applications include emergency stop circuits, safety interlocks, and other critical control functions requiring forced-guided relay contacts for reliable fault detection.
